摘要
A metal-organic framework, Cu-3(BTC)(2), was synthesized and applied as an electro-responsive electrorheological material dispersed in insulating oil. Powder of crystalline Cu-3(BTC)(2) exhibited excellent chain-like structures and controllable rheological properties in an applied electric field.
